Was watching Cade earlier and although I like him and he is talented and versatile, some things about his game are meh. First of all, he coasts a lot, plays at a very slow pace and doesn't look like he has the speed or burst even when he tries to push tempo. Second, he isn't really a perimeter player. He is very mid range and low post oriented. I'm starting to see a lot of Shaun Livingston in his game. Now, can he still have success in the league and become a star? Yeah absolutely, but I'm not sure how he'd fit on the Knicks honestly. I see Cade and RJ being almost redundant.
Cade is going to have to play on a team that has quality shooters and floor spacers around him so he can operate in his comfort zones. There might be more perimeter skill in his game than he's shown so far but right now I'm starting to question his fit with the guys we have.

Said something very similar the other day and it’s why I’m more into Suggs more for the Knicks. Cade plays bully ball exactly like RJ. Posting dudes up, driving to the hoop with guys attached to the hip. Suggs just has that burst you need as a primary ball handler. I kinda hope cade’s in like bad shape or something cuz I thought he looked slow out there too. He’s gotta get on the Steph curry dribble training regime or something cuz he needs to get more creative with the ball if he’s this slow all the time.
